Well, I was in the same situation with clearcredit.com a few months ago. First....let me say that these "credit monitoring" companies that tell you they can get you a "free" copy of your credit report (only if you sign up with their "service"!)are NOT wanting to tell consumers about the FACT Act of 2004! Every consumer is now entitled to a copy of their credit report & score from all three major CRA's! So these companies that are using the old ploy of waving around a not so free credit report can go F*#% themselves!!!! Second....the "credit monitoring service" they are providing is a complete sham!All they do is dispute EVERYTHING on your credit report and then charge you (the consumer) a freakin' arm and a leg to do it!
